Agricultural Field Day at Doncaster's Farm

10am-4pm, 173 Main Street agri
This is a fun family event not to be missed! Farm activities ranging from a corn “maize”, antique sale, petting zoo, pony rides, antique vs. modern threshing demonstrations, u-pick potatoes, produce vendors, a special apple pie baking contest and the list goes on.

Carlos del Junco, sponsored by the Tantramarsh Blues Society

Fall Fair - Carlos Del Junco
9pm-Midnight
Born in Havana Cuba, this Canadian blues artist is renowned around the world for his soulful harmonica style. This is a show not to be missed. Presented by the Tantramarsh Blues Society.
